Incident Summary:

08/01/2019: Assailants threw petrol bombs and paint bombs at police officers in Belfast, Northern Ireland, United Kingdom. This was one of two related incidents to occur in Belfast on this night. There were no reported casualties, but a number of vehicles were damaged across the two attacks. No group claimed responsibility for the incident.
